Default 2009 189FBR - New AC cover shroud

Folks,
Any idea on where to locate the model number for my AC unit. Of course when I took the cover off to inspect and clean the unit, I dropped it over the side. It easily broke after ten plus years in the sun.
I found a replacement on Amazon but want to match model numbers.

We have a 2007 FF (x210) that’s likely to have the same brand and perhaps even same model A/C unit as your 189. I just checked and found that the info you are seeking can be found by removing the intake vent/filter cover just in front of the control panel on the ceiling inside the camper. The specification, model number & serial number stickers are easily visible. Be cautious with release tabs when pulling the vent panel down. Like your aged rooftop cowl, the plastic on the inside components may also be quite brittle. In the words of Profdant139, “don’t ask me how I know this” .

I have a 2011 189 FBS. The Model number was under the shroud on the side. The one I found on Amazon had a very similar number but not exact number. Since I have Prime and it was an available Prime item, I took the chance and it fit perfectly.
